Why These Are the Top GMC Repair Auto Repair Shops in Vernon

The GMC repair market in Vernon, Illinois, is characteristic of a small, rural community. The competition is not dense, but the existing providers are well-established and rely heavily on their local reputation and word-of-mouth referrals. You will not find a dedicated GMC or Cadillac dealership within Vernon itself; the nearest are typically a 30-45 minute drive away in larger cities like Centralia or Mt. Vernon. **Average Quality:** The quality of service is generally high, as these small businesses survive by building trust within the community. They are adept at handling the needs of local farmers, tradespeople, and families who rely on their trucks. **Competition Level:** Moderate to low. The shops listed are the primary options, and they each have a loyal customer base. There is little pressure from large corporate chains.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is generally more competitive than at a dealership but aligns with standard independent shop labor rates for Southern Illinois, which are typically between $90 - $120 per hour. For highly specialized services like in-depth Duramax or Allison transmission work, some customers may still need to travel to a specialist outside of Vernon, potentially incurring higher costs.

What are the most common GMC repair issues for drivers in the Vernon, Illinois area?

In Vernon and surrounding rural areas, GMC trucks and SUVs often need suspension and brake repairs due to rough country roads and frequent hauling. We also frequently address issues related to the 5.3L V8 engine, such as lifter failure and oil consumption, which are common in models like the Sierra and Yukon. Local shops are very familiar with these recurring problems specific to GMC's popular models.

When should I seek professional service for my GMC instead of attempting a DIY repair?

Immediately seek a professional for any check engine light, transmission issues, or complex electrical problems, as modern GMC vehicles require specialized computer diagnostics. For Vernon residents who rely on their trucks for daily work or farming, it's also wise to get professional help for safety-critical systems like brakes or steering to avoid costly downtime or accidents.

What local factors in the Vernon area should I consider for maintaining my GMC?

The local climate with hot summers, cold winters, and road salt demands special attention to your cooling system and undercarriage to prevent rust. Furthermore, if you use your GMC for farming or towing heavy loads on rural roads, you should adhere to more frequent transmission fluid and differential service intervals than the standard manual suggests. A local shop familiar with these conditions can provide the best maintenance schedule.
